Transaction efcdabc90a420365972fffab148272809d7a13af14006c3fe60124de6024a53c
1 Input
2 Outputs
- efcdabc90a420365972fffab148272809d7a13af14006c3fe60124de6024a53c:0
- efcdabc90a420365972fffab148272809d7a13af14006c3fe60124de6024a53c:1
value 24487
address 1LnRGrsS3ZKz4aGMw38fLnwxr7twyq26GS
value 89455
address 1F9vGivfBZbXZvpffK6rj4yQQtpL25GqAd